Understanding the Science Behind Weight Loss
When it comes to weight loss, understanding the science behind it is key to achieving lasting results. It’s not just about cutting calories or hitting the gym; there’s a whole biological process at play that can impact your success. By delving into the intricacies of how our bodies store and burn fat, you can tailor your approach to weight loss for maximum effectiveness.
One fundamental concept to grasp is the importance of creating a caloric deficit. Simply put, you need to burn more calories than you consume to lose weight. This can be achieved through a combination of diet and exercise. **Consistency** is crucial here; small, sustainable changes over time are more likely to lead to lasting results than extreme, short-term measures.
Another key factor in weight loss is **metabolism**. Your metabolism refers to the rate at which your body burns calories to keep you alive and functioning. Factors such as age, gender, genetics, and muscle mass all play a role in determining your metabolism. Building muscle through strength training can help increase your metabolism, making it easier to maintain a healthy weight.
It’s important to remember that weight loss is a journey, not a destination. **Patience** and perseverance are essential when striving for lasting results. By arming yourself with knowledge about the science behind weight loss and adopting a healthy, sustainable approach, you can achieve your goals and maintain a healthy lifestyle in the long run.
Developing Healthy Habits for Long-Term Success
When it comes to achieving lasting weight loss results, developing healthy habits is key. These habits not only help you shed pounds but also keep them off in the long term. Here are some practical tips to help you develop healthy habits for long-term success:
- Start Small: Don’t try to overhaul your entire lifestyle overnight. Instead, start by making small changes to your daily routine, such as swapping out sugary drinks for water or taking the stairs instead of the elevator.
- Set Realistic Goals: While it’s important to have big goals, it’s also crucial to set smaller, achievable milestones along the way. This will help you stay motivated and track your progress.
- Stay Consistent: Consistency is key when it comes to developing healthy habits. Try to stick to your new routine as much as possible, even when you feel tempted to stray.
By incorporating these tips into your daily life, you’ll be well on your way to achieving lasting weight loss results. Remember, developing healthy habits takes time, so be patient with yourself and stay committed to your goals.
Navigating Common Pitfalls in Weight Loss Journeys
When embarking on a weight loss journey, it’s important to be aware of common pitfalls that can derail your progress. By understanding these challenges and learning how to navigate them, you can set yourself up for success in achieving lasting results.
One common pitfall in weight loss journeys is setting unrealistic expectations. It’s important to remember that healthy weight loss takes time and consistent effort. Instead of aiming for a quick fix, focus on making sustainable lifestyle changes that you can maintain in the long term.
Another pitfall to watch out for is falling into the trap of fad diets or extreme restrictions. These approaches may lead to short-term results, but they are often unsustainable and can be detrimental to your overall health. Instead, focus on balanced nutrition and portion control, incorporating a variety of whole foods into your diet.
Lastly, it’s easy to get discouraged when progress seems slow or when facing setbacks. Remember that weight loss is not linear, and it’s okay to have ups and downs along the way. Stay motivated by setting small, achievable goals, celebrating your successes, and seeking support from friends, family, or a healthcare professional.
